Tech Executive Leaves High-Paying Job After Amassing $1.5 Million in Savings
In a bold move that has sparked conversations about financial freedom and lifestyle choices, a 37-year-old woman has decided to leave her lucrative position at Google, earning $390,000 annually. Her decision comes after years of diligent saving, culminating in a remarkable $1.5 million nest egg. This life change not only raises eyebrows but serves as a poignant reminder of the values we live by and the choices we make in pursuit of happiness.
Prioritizing Purpose Over Paychecks
The individual, whose story is shared extensively on various platforms, highlights a significant shift from valuing financial gain to prioritizing personal fulfillment. She attributes her success to disciplined budgeting, a "no-buy checklist," and a conscious decision to differentiate between needs and wants. This practice echoes biblical principles of stewardship and intentional living. In Matthew 6:19-21, Jesus teaches, “Do not store up for yourselves treasures on earth… For where your treasure is, there your heart will be also.”
